Evaluation of the Therapeutic Efficacy of Auricular Pellets Combined With Atorvastatin 20mg in Patients With Dyslipidemia and Phlegm-Dampness Syndrome
The Potential Efficacy of Auricular Pellets Combined With Atorvastatin 20mg in Managing Blood Lipid Levels and Improving Phlegm-Dampness Symptoms in 80 Patients With Dyslipidemia and Phlegm-Dampness Syndrome: A Randomized Controlled Trial
Dyslipidemia (DL) is a metabolic disorder characterized by abnormal levels of blood lipids and is an important risk factor for cardiovascular disease. Although current management primarily relies on lifestyle modification and lipid-lowering medications, particularly statins, some patients may have an inadequate treatment response, experience adverse effects, or have difficulty maintaining long-term adherence.
Traditional Chinese Medicine therapies are increasingly used as complementary approaches to conventional treatment. Auricular acupuncture, which stimulates specific acupoints on the ear, has been investigated for its potential effects on lipid metabolism. In Traditional Chinese Medicine, Phlegm-Dampness syndrome is considered a common syndrome pattern associated with dyslipidemia. However, clinical evidence regarding the effects of auricular acupuncture on blood lipid parameters and Phlegm-Dampness symptoms in patients with dyslipidemia remains limited, particularly in Vietnam.
This randomized controlled trial evaluates the effects of auricular acupuncture combined with atorvastatin compared with atorvastatin plus sham auricular acupuncture in patients with dyslipidemia presenting with Phlegm-Dampness syndrome. The primary outcome is the change in blood lipid parameters, including total cholesterol (TC), triglycerides (TG), low-density lipoprotein cholesterol (LDL-C), and high-density lipoprotein cholesterol (HDL-C), from baseline to the end of the 8-week intervention. Changes in clinical symptoms of Phlegm-Dampness syndrome are also evaluated.

Detailed Description
This single-blind, randomized, sham-controlled clinical trial includes 80 outpatients aged 18 years or older with dyslipidemia presenting with Phlegm-Dampness syndrome at Le Van Thinh Hospital, Ho Chi Minh City, Vietnam. Only participants are blinded to group allocation. Participants are randomly assigned to two equal groups. Both groups receive atorvastatin 20 mg once daily after dinner and are advised to follow a lipid-lowering, high-fiber diet.
The intervention group receives Khanh Phong intradermal auricular needles applied to five auricular acupoints: Pi (CO13), Stomach (CO4), Endocrine (CO18), Sympathetic (AH6a), and Shenmen (TF4). The therapeutic points are selected according to traditional medicine treatment principles for Phlegm-Dampness syndrome and the Vietnamese traditional medicine guideline. Participants are instructed to perform self-acupressure four times daily. The control group receives sham auricular acupuncture performed by inserting the same type of intradermal auricular needles used in the intervention group at three predefined auricular points considered theoretically unrelated to the treatment of dyslipidemia and Phlegm-Dampness syndrome: Finger (SF1), Thoracic Spine (AH11), and Knee (AH4). Participants in the control group are not instructed to perform self-acupressure.
The intervention period lasts 8 weeks. In both groups, intradermal auricular needles are applied at the initial treatment session and subsequently replaced every 5 days, for a total of 12 treatment sessions. In the intervention group, the treated ear is alternated between sessions; in the control group, the needles are applied to the left ear. Participants are monitored for 15 minutes after each procedure and are instructed regarding monitoring for potential adverse events, including fainting, localized pain or swelling, ear bleeding, infection, and perichondritis.
Blood lipid parameters, including total cholesterol (TC), triglycerides (TG), low-density lipoprotein cholesterol (LDL-C), and high-density lipoprotein cholesterol (HDL-C), are measured at baseline (T0) and after the 8-week intervention (T8). The primary outcome is the change in these blood lipid parameters from baseline to T8. Secondary outcomes include the percentage improvement in the nine-symptom Phlegm-Dampness syndrome score, assessed at baseline and every 15 days during the intervention, and the incidence of treatment-emergent adverse events throughout the 8-week study period.

Inclusion Criteria:
- Diagnosis: Dyslipidemia (DL), untreated or discontinued treatment for at least 1 month, and not taking drugs that induce DL.
- Laboratory Criteria: LDL-c levels between 2.6 and 4.9 mmol/L.
- TCM Criteria:
Diagnosed with Phlegm-Dampness syndrome in patients with DL according to the "Guiding Principles for Clinical Research on Combined Traditional Chinese and Western Medicine":
Primary symptoms: Obesity, heavy sensation in the head, chest tightness, nausea/phlegm expectoration, numbness in limbs.
Secondary symptoms: Palpitations, insomnia, bland taste in the mouth, poor appetite.
Tongue manifestations: Enlarged/flabby tongue, greasy/slippery tongue coating. Pulse: String-taut and slippery pulse (Wiry-Slippery pulse). Diagnostic threshold: Confirmed when presenting >= 50% of TCM Phlegm-Dampness syndrome symptoms in patients with DL.

Percentage Improvement in Phlegm-Dampness Syndrome Clinical Symptom Score
Time Frame: Baseline, Day 15, Day 30, Day 45, and Day 60 (Week 8)
|
Phlegm-Dampness syndrome clinical symptoms are assessed using a 9-item symptom score based on the Guidelines for Clinical Research on New Chinese Medicine Drugs (Zhongyao Xinyao Linchuang Yanjiu Zhidao Yuanze, 2002), published by the Ministry of Health of the People's Republic of China.
The scale assesses nine symptoms: obesity/overweight, heavy sensation in the head, chest tightness, nausea/expectoration of phlegm, numbness of the limbs, palpitations, bland taste in the mouth, reduced appetite, and insomnia.
Each item is scored from 0 (absent) to 3 (severe), resulting in a total score ranging from 0 to 27.
Higher total scores indicate greater symptom severity and therefore a worse outcome; lower total scores indicate less severe symptoms and therefore a better outcome.
The percentage improvement is calculated based on the reduction in the total symptom score from baseline at each assessment time point.
